The efficient production of high-quality tissue paper hinges on several critical processes, not least of which is the proper functioning of the Yankee cylinder. This large, heated cylinder is central to both drying the paper web and imparting the desired softness through creping. To ensure this complex operation runs smoothly, dryer release agents, often categorized as creping adhesive agents, are vital. These specialized chemicals are engineered to create a precisely controlled interface between the drying cylinder and the paper web, facilitating both efficient creping and preventing unwanted adhesion.

The primary function of a dryer release agent is to modify the surface of the Yankee cylinder. It forms a thin, uniform coating that strikes a delicate balance: it needs to be sticky enough to allow the creping blade to effectively grab and fold the fibers, thereby enhancing softness and bulk, but not so adhesive that the paper adheres permanently to the cylinder. This careful calibration is what enables the characteristic softness and stretch of tissue paper. Without the correct application of these agents, issues like sheet tearing, incomplete creping, or poor product quality can arise.

Beyond facilitating the creping action, dryer release agents also serve a crucial protective role for the Yankee cylinder and the doctor blade. The constant contact and friction between the blade and the cylinder can lead to wear and damage. The release agent acts as a lubricant and a protective film, minimizing this abrasive interaction. This protection is essential for maintaining the cylinder's polished surface finish, which is critical for uniform drying and consistent creping performance over time. It also helps prolong the life of the doctor blade itself.

For tissue paper manufacturers, sourcing reliable dryer release agents is a key operational consideration. Many opt to purchase these chemicals from established suppliers, particularly those in regions like China known for their robust chemical manufacturing capabilities. When evaluating potential suppliers, factors like product consistency, technical specifications (such as appearance, active content, and pH), and adherence to environmental standards are important. Understanding the suggested dosage, typically within a range like 0.3-0.8 kg per ton of dry paper, is also crucial for efficient use.
